Contributor Awards 2025

In previous years, the Kubernetes community recognized contributors who have gone above and beyond with the annual Kubernetes Contributor Awards. With the creation of a Maintainer Summit, we want to expand this to all graduated projects! All graduated projects will now be able to nominate contributors to receive a physical award, usually in the form of a square canvas print. Projects may only submit for awards once per calendar year. That means if a project submits for Maintainer Summit EU 2026, they cannot submit again for NA 2026.

KubeCon NA Maintainer Summit T-Shirt Design
It’s time to flex that creative muscle! For this Maintainer Summit we want to solicit designs for our attendee t-shirts! Anyone eligible to attend the maintainer summit can submit art ideas, and the designs will be chosen by this summit’s program chairs.

Design submissions should follow these guidelines:

  • Vector (svg) format. Inkscape is a free, open source tool that can be used to create vector graphics.
  • Use 3 colors (5 max). The cost of printing increases with each color added. The fewer colors you use, the more affordable it will be for the community to have swag produced.
  • The CNCF Code of Conduct applies. Submissions that do not follow the code of conduct will not be considered.
  • No AI. AI-generated image content is not permitted in any form due to the likelihood of infringement. Do not use AI-generated imagery in any way in your design.

The deadline to submit is August 8th, and the winner will be chosen and informed August 12th.

New Policy on Resource Usage

To be good stewards of the resources donated to us by various providers, we CNCF folks need to change how we’re handing out and monitoring project usage of cloud/provider resources. To that end, we’ve written a policy around projects requesting and using compute resources.

TL;DR:

CNCF will have hosted GHA Runners for you to use across all our major providers. If a provider/architecture/shape doesn’t exist, please contact CNCF staff, and we will add it. Unless there are extenuating circumstances, you should shape your CI to work within GitHub Actions. Resources just for CI/CD must be re-requested and approved by CNCF Staff. Non-ephemeral resources need to be re-requested every six months. At seven months, those resources are subject to deletion. This will go into effect in September 2024, with staff reaching out to projects over the coming months to discuss their usage and identify a path forward

GitHub Merge Queues

GitHub Merge Queues are now generally available (https://github.blog/2023-07-12-github-merge-queue-is-generally-available/). The merge queue workflow allows busy teams to land changes into the main branch more efficiently. It does this by creating an independent branch of each approved change which is then added to a queue. As an item is added to the queue it is branched along with the upstream changes that are ahead of that merge in the queue, allowing for continuous merging while enforcing all the status checks. Artifact Hub Expands Artifact Support

Artifacthub.io is an indexer of cloud native deployment artifacts. It doesn’t host these artifacts, but allows projects to index their artifacts so that it’s more discoverable by users. This is handy if you publish your artifacts in multiple registries, or have a collection that you’d like to recommend to your users. Each entry also includes a social integration card so that you can embed the information in your README or website.

Over the past year Artifact Hub has gained support for more than just container images. You can also register Helm charts and plugins, Falco configurations, Open Policy Agent (OPA) and Gatekeeper policies, OLM operators, Tinkerbell actions, kubectl plugins, Tekton tasks and pipelines, KEDA scalers, CoreDNS plugins, Keptn integrations, container images, Kubewarden policies, Kyverno policies, Knative client, Backstage plugins, Argo templates and KubeArmor policies.

There’s a new Sheriff in town - maintaining repo access permissions on the CNCF org When you want to grant access to your project repos to maintainers and collaborators, please submit a pull request to update the config.yaml file in the cncf/people repo. Sheriff is being used to centralize repo access control for the CNCF org on GitHub. Sheriff runs once per hour, is launched from a Github Action on cncf/people, and it will undo any changes to repo permissions that are made via a repo's settings.yml file. Using Sheriff makes it easy for us to review who has access to all community repos in the CNCF org. Sheriff also allows us to structure our teams to reflect team roles and Sheriff teams are cross platform.
